Brazil's ICUMSA 45 Sugar Manufacturers: A Comprehensive Overview
Brazil, a global exporter of sugar, boasts a significant number of manufacturers specializing in ICUMSA 45 sugar. This unique grade, identified by its comparatively low color measurement, is highly sought after for industrial applications, like beverage creation. Numerous Brazilian enterprises have invested in optimizing their techniques to meet this requirement, resulting to a robust market. These firms usually employ modern equipment and rigorous quality testing systems. Understanding a landscape requires considering factors such as production capacity, location distribution, and international strategies.
Key producers feature Cosan, Biosev, and Raízen.
The region of São Paulo constitutes a substantial portion of this ICUMSA 45 sweetener production.
Export destinations mostly feature Western markets and the Far East.

Sourcing ICUMSA 45 Sugar: Key Manufacturers and Price Considerations
Acquiring high-grade ICUMSA 45 sugar requires careful evaluation of both producers and cost . Several prominent organizations dominate the worldwide market. These feature producers like Sucden, Louis Dreyfus Company , and Tate & Lyle . Others, such as Mitsui and several overseas mills, are significant players. Price variations are heavily impacted by several factors. These typically include raw sugar trade trends , exchange rates, transportation expenses, and local need. Typically, expect a value of $400 - $700 each tonne CIF depending on quantity and shipping destination. Review multiple bids from varied suppliers .
